NFL Week 2 injuries, inactives, live updates: Cowboys' Brandin Cooks out; Cam Akers a healthy scratch for Rams

One week into the NFL season has already taken its toll on the players. As the injury list grows heading into Week 2, so does the prominent names on the inactive list. Another full NFL Sunday is set to begin, with plenty of big names awaiting their official game status. 

The Green Bay Packers were hit hard by injuries this week, as three key players on offense are inactive. Wide receiver Christian Watson, running back Aaron Jones and offensive tackle David Bakhtiari are all out vs. the Falcons.

The Chargers will be without Austin Ekeler, who was ruled out on Saturday with an ankle injury, while Joey Bosa is expected to play despite a hamstring injury. Ravens tight end Mark Andrews (ankle) listed as questionable, will play against the Bengals.

Travis Kelce (knee) will play for the Chiefs, while Raiders wide receiver Jakobi Meyers (concussion) will not play this week. Cowboys wide receiver Brandin Cooks (knee) is questionable, but not expected to play against the Jets.

Cowboys

Dallas will be without wide receiver Brandin Cooks, who did not practice this week due to a knee injury. Safety Donovan Wilson and guard Tyler Smith are other notable inactives. Here are the rest of the players sidelined on Sunday:

  • WR Brandin Cooks
  • S Donovan Wilson
  • QB Trey Lance (emergency 3rd QB)
  • CB Noah Igbinoghene
  • CB Eric Scott
  • G Tyler Smith
  • DL Viliami Fehoko

Tunsil out for Texans

While CJ Stroud will play, he loses yet another offensive lineman with Laremy Tunsil out with a knee injury. He is the fourth regular offensive starter the Texans won't have today.

Titans first-round pick inactive

Titans O-lineman and first-round pick Peter Skoronski is inactive after needing an appendectomy during the week. Xavier Newman, who has played in one career regular season game, is in line to replace Skoronski in the starting lineup.

Hamlin out for Bills 

Damar Hamlin is inactive for a second straight week and has not played since Buffalo's Week 17 game against Cincinnati last December. O-lineman Mitch Morse (finger) was the only Bills player who was on this week's practice report.

Meyers out for Vegas

Wideout Jakobi Meyers (concussion) will not be in uniform today for the Raiders. Also out for Vegas is Chandler Jones, who continues be inactive for personal reasons. Meyers' absence will likely lead to more targets for DeAndre Carter, who had just one catch for five yards last week.

Kelce, Jones to make season debuts for KC 

As expected, Travis Kelce (knee) and Chris Jones will play after missing the Chiefs' season-opening loss to Detroit. Kelce's presence will surely be a big boost for Patrick Mahomes after he was bedeviled by his receiving corps against the Lions.

Bengals rookie RB to make regular season debut 

With running back Chris Evans injured and inactive, Bengals rookie RB Chase Brown will make his NFL debut today. Brown ran for 1,643 yards and 10 scores during his final game at Illinois. 

In other Bengals injury news, backup OT Jackson Carmen is out today, so D'Ante Smith is in line to play if Orlando Browns or Jonah Williams sustains an injury.

Moss back for Colts 

As expected, Colt running back Zack Moss is back in the lineup today after missing Week 1 with a shoulder injury. Moss is the Colts' starter with Jonathan Taylor out at least the next three games on the team's PUP list.
